French hat-trick in BMX, double in road cycling, gold for Pauline Ferrand-Prévot and silver for Victor Koretzky in mountain biking… French cycling shone this summer during the Olympic Games but also Paris 2024 Paralympics (28 medals). And in the region, it is the young Louis Ledoux who shines with his performances.
French cyclo-cross champion at the start of the year, the 14-year-old cyclist who lives in the town of Juvignies north of Beauvais (Oise) won a French MTB Cup on September 22 in Agde (Hérault). Already a great track record even though he started cycling only… three years ago.
“I did different sports before and we found the Team Oise organization where I hung out in La Neuville-en-Hez and I really liked this sport »says the 3rd grade studente who will take his certificate at Notre-Dame de Beauvais college this year.
Followed seven to eight hours a week on average, his weekends are often occupied by his Tour de France mountain bike competitions alongside his parents who support him and who get involved in the game even though they don’t come “not a bike at all”as his father tells us.

Join a sport-study
With the days starting to get shorter and the weather not helping, Yves bought his son a road bike so he can continue training. Especially since Louis’ second part of the season will begin with cyclo-cross, another equally demanding cycling discipline:
However, that did not prevent him from winning the French U15 champion jersey at the start of the year. But this time, the young pilot is moving into the cadet category where there are more people on the starting line. However, his good performances in the juniors allowed him to start among the first.
With a primary desire to “discover this category” before setting results objectives, Louis participates in the French Cyclo-cross Cup held in Nommay in Doubs this Sunday, October 20. His next step: trying to join the Pôle France Jeunes VTT in Besançon.
